Hi was a successful and highly respected businessman/entrepreneur in the manufacturing, aerospace, and health services industries. His community involvement included the Fire Dept, West Valley LAPD, and Encino Neighborhood Council.
Hi was a loving and devoted husband to his wife of seventy-one years, Bee. He was a loving and devoted father to Chuck (Barbara) and David (Paula) and a loving and supportive grandfather to six grandchildren, Adam (Chrissie), Stacy (Brent), Lisa (Rick), Bobby, Alan (Jana), and Jeff. He was a great-grandfather to nine cherished great-grandchildren.
Funeral services will take place at Hillside Memorial Park Cemetery on Tuesday, August 9, 2011 at 11:00 a.m.
Published in the Los Angeles Times on August 9, 2011.
